He's been Prime Minister of Israel multiple times, a feat that speaks volumes about his resilience and political savvy. We've seen him navigate intense security challenges, forge controversial alliances, and implement significant policy changes. Remember the Iran nuclear deal? Netanyahu was one of its most vocal critics on the international stage, making powerful speeches and lobbying heavily against it. That was a huge moment. He also played a significant role in the Abraham Accords, which normalized relations between Israel and several Arab nations. That was a game-changer, and a major diplomatic achievement. The Legacy and Future

What's Benjamin Netanyahu's legacy going to be? That's the million-dollar question, right? He's undeniably left a massive imprint on Israel and the Middle East. Supporters praise his strong stance on security, his economic policies, and his role in strengthening Israel's international standing. They see him as a leader who consistently put Israel's interests first and fought tirelessly for its security. His supporters often highlight his long tenure as proof of his effectiveness and his ability to connect with the Israeli electorate. They point to periods of economic growth and increased security under his leadership as evidence of his successful policies. He's often seen as the defender of the Jewish state, a bulwark against its enemies, and a shrewd negotiator capable of securing Israel's place in a hostile region. His detractors, on the other hand, point to his controversial policies, his divisive rhetoric, and the legal challenges he's faced. They argue that his leadership has deepened political polarization within Israel and that his actions have sometimes undermined democratic institutions. Concerns about corruption and abuse of power have been central to the criticisms leveled against him. The long-term impact of his policies on the peace process and regional stability is also a subject of intense debate.
